## Runbook: Thumbnail Generation Queue (Pixelloft)

The thumbnail queue drains through three workers on the render pool. If the backlog exceeds 10k items, scale workers to six and purge any jobs older than 24 hours using the admin CLI. Failed jobs retry twice before landing in the dead-letter topic; do not replay them during a release window. Workers read their configuration from the standard env file, and each one needs credentials for the asset store, set on this line:

env line for fafof-fahag: LEDGER_TOKEN5=f8790

## Relevance Tuning Notes

Search ranking for Pellamore is tuned per release. Boost weights live in ranker.yaml; do not edit mid-cycle. Re-run the relevance suite after any synonym pack update and attach scores to the release ticket. The suite hits the staging index, which requires the scoring-service credential in the local env file. Ensure the file includes this line before running:

env line for yahip-tafog: RELAY_SECRET3=4ca

## Data Stores: Admin Table Bulk Edits

Heads up: bulk edits to the `feature_flags` admin table should only happen during a release window. Use the `bulked` CLI rather than raw SQL — it writes an audit row for each change and supports dry runs. Snapshot the table first with `bulked snapshot`. The tool reads its target from the connection string below.

primary connection of tawif-yajeg = postgresql://rusiel_svc:G879q9cx6GsSvj@db-dd9f.norvagrid.internal:5432/casath